Collingwood Costumes is an all-equity firm with 80 million shares outstanding.Collingwood has $75 million in cash,and expects future free cash flows of $15 million per year.The cash can be used to expand the firm's future operations,increasing future free cash flows to $16 million per year.If Collingwood's cost of capital for the expansion is 10%,what will be the difference in the firm's share price compared to using the cash for a share repurchase?
